Development Orchestrator
Purpose
Provide one executable path through the development environment. This document decides which module runs, in what order, what state passes forward, and where the process must stop for the author.
Default pipeline
scope -> retrieve -> classify authority -> Gap Analyzer -> choose mode/scale -> diverge cheaply -> shortlist -> optional research -> expand one branch -> Character Factory as needed -> structure packet -> optional development prototype -> relevant critics -> author gate -> approved integration -> next-state record
When recent research, brainstorming, and canon have accumulated but no single candidate has been selected, insert Research → Creative Possibilities / Inspiration Pass after status-safe extraction and gap analysis. It creates a portfolio for author interest selection; it does not replace the later author gate or critics.
Finished-novel drafting is not part of the default pipeline.
When work comes from the weekly completion set, Story Completion Workflow controls horizontal progression. The orchestrator runs one task at the current sweep depth; it does not take that task through every scale before the rest of the registry catches up.
Step 1 — Scope the run
Declare:
- one target;
- current scale: era, arc, sequence, chapter, scene, or prototype;
- classification: close-gap, strengthen-structure, or new-expansion;
- explicit exclusions;
- stop condition;
- token mode: Micro, Standard, Deep, or Cascade.
Default to close-gap. Use Cascade only when the author asks to move from broad structure into a representative story sample in one run.

Step 5 — Diverge breadth-first
Generate compact alternatives before detailed development.
- Micro: 3 narrow options.
- Standard: 4–6 options; expand the best 2.
- Deep: 5–10 broad options; shortlist 3.
- Cascade: 3–5 broad options; follow only 1 working branch downward.
An AI shortlist is a recommendation, not author approval or canon.

Step 6 — Research selectively
Research only when the result could change plausibility, mechanism, constraints, or dramatic possibilities. Translate findings through:
mechanism -> human pressure -> Seeds behavior -> concrete situation -> choice -> consequence
Label supported fact, extrapolation, premise, and unsupported material. Research cannot resolve a story choice.

Step 9 — Prototype only when useful
A 500–1,500 word development prototype is appropriate when prose-in-motion can test dialogue, explanation, chemistry, objective clarity, or emotional effect better than an outline.
Every prototype package must state:
- what it tests;
- provisional inventions;
- what worked;
- what failed;
- decisions still required.
Readable does not mean manuscript-ready. Prototype prose never establishes canon.

Hard stop conditions
Stop before further expansion when:
- a load-bearing author choice is unresolved;
- sources conflict and authority is unclear;
- research is needed to distinguish viable mechanisms;
- a candidate would require canonizing a new system rule;
- the current scale does not support moving downward;
- the token mode's depth limit has been reached;
- the candidate reaches the dedicated Samuel–Konrad hierarchy boundary.
